Module: TranscribeMe::API

Defined in:
lib/transcribeme/api/client.rb,
lib/transcribeme/api/session.rb,
lib/transcribeme/transcribeme.rb,
lib/transcribeme/api/recordings.rb,
lib/transcribeme/api/submission.rb,
lib/transcribeme/api/upload_url.rb,
lib/transcribeme/api/customer_login.rb,
lib/transcribeme/api/finalize_session.rb,
lib/transcribeme/api/check_transcription_ready.rb,
lib/transcribeme/api/submission_with_promocode.rb

Defined Under Namespace

Classes: CheckTranscriptionReady, Client, CustomerLogin, FinalizeSession, Recordings, Session, Submission, SubmissionWithPromocode, UploadUrl

Constant Summary collapse

WSDL =
"http://transcribeme-api.cloudapp.net/PortalAPI.svc?wsdl=wsdl0"
ENDPOINT =
"http://transcribeme-api.cloudapp.net/PortalAPI.svc"
NAMESPACE =
"http://TranscribeMe.API.Web"
NAMESPACE_IDENTIFIER =

any indentifier can be used

:tns
SOAP_ENVELOPE =
["soapenv:Envelope", { "xmlns:soapenv" => "http://schemas.xmlsoap.org/soap/envelope/", "xmlns:#{NAMESPACE_IDENTIFIER}" => NAMESPACE }]